Number of tanks The number of feedstock tanks for the units of refineries shall ply with the following provisions: 1. Tanks of crude oil and feedstock When one unit is used for processing one kind of feedstock, 3 ~ 4 tanks should be used. When one unit is used for processing several kinds of feedstock, additional 2 ~ 3 tanks should be provided for every increase of one kind of feedstock to be added in the unit. 6 2. Intermediate feedstock oil tank a. When unit is fed directly or supplied partially by storage tanks, 2 ~ 3 tanks should be provided. When unit is supplied by storage tanks, 3 ~ 4 tanks should be provided. b. For the refining unit, 2 ~ 3 tanks should be provided for every position to be handled separately. d. For the reforming unit, an additional tank may be provided for the prehydrogenation generated oil tank according to the requirements of unit. e. For the lubeoil unit, 2 tanks should be provided for the oil of every kind of positions, and tanks shall be provided separately for oil with same kind of positions but having different carbon residues or different processing depths. 3. The capacity of each tank of crude oil and feedstock oil shall not be less than the daily capacity to be handled by one unit under the normal operation. Number of product oil tanks shall ply with the following provisions: 1. Gasoline tanks and diesel oil tanks a. Two tanks should be provided for each position to be controlled for the product oil characteristics. b. When oils of a brand and grade are produced, the total number of blending tanks and product oil tanks should not be less than 4, and additional 2 ~ 3 tanks may be added for every increase of one brand. 2. Tanks of aviation gasoline and jet fuel a. 2 ~ 3 tanks should be provided for each position. b. The total number of blending tanks and product oil tanks for each brand and grade should not be less than 3. 3. It is remended to provide 3 ~ 4 tanks for the military diesel oil. 4. It is remended to provide 2 tanks for each brand and grade of solvent oil and lamp kerosene. 5. It is remended to provide 2 tanks for each type of product of aromatics. 6. Number of LPG tanks should not be less than 2. 7. Heavy oil tank (fuel oil tank) a. When one brand and grade of product oil, the number of blending tank and product oil tank should not be less than 3, and another 2 tanks may added for every increase in one brand and grade of product oil. b. When the temperature at inlet of tanks is in a range of 120 ~ 200 oC, the separate tanks shall be provided and 1 ~ 2 blow up tanks shall be provided. c. It is remended to provide 2 tanks for the fuel oil of the plant. 8. Storage tanks of lubeoils, oils for electrical appliances and hydraulic oils a. It is remended to provide 2 tanks for each position, and the separate tank shall be provided for oil with the same kind of positions but having different carbon residues or different processing depth. b. It is remended to provide 1 ~ 2 tanks for each brand of product oil, and the product oil tank is also used as the blending tank. c. Blending and product tanks of Grade 1 oil shall be used dedicatedly according to brand and grades. The 7 blending and product tanks of Grade 2 and Grade 3 may used alternatively provided that the quality is not affected. 9. Asphalt tanks should not be less than 2. Number of effluent oil shall ply with the following provisions: 1. It is remended to provide 2 tanks respectively for the effluent light oil and the effluent heavy oil. 2. It is remended to provide 1 ~ 2 tanks for catalyzed and cracked oil slurry. Number of the storage tanks for petrochemical media shall ply with the following provisions: 1. Liquid hydrocarbon tanks a. Ethylene tanks should not be less than 2. b. Propylene tanks should not be less than 2. c. It is remended to provide 2 tanks for each kind of medium of C4 and C5 hydrocarbon. 2. It is remended to provide 2 tanks for each medium of aromatics. 3. It is remended to provide 1 ~ 2 tanks for each medium of alcohols, aldehydes, esters, ketones, nitriles and the other media with the similar characteristics. The number of storage tanks provided for acids, alkalis and liquid ammonia should not be less than 2 for each kind of medium. 3. Accessories and Instruments of Storage Tanks Accessories of storage tanks Floating roof tanks and inner floating roof tanks shall be provided with oil dip holes, manholes, blowdown holes (or cleaning holes) and drain nozzle. It is remended to provide the bottom samplers and the number shall be defined according Table . Table Oil Dip Holes, Manholes, Blowdown Holes (or Cleaning Holes), Drain Nozzles and Bottom Samplers Capacity of tank (M3) Oil dip hole (place) Manhole (place) Blowdown hole (or cleaning hole) (place) Drain nozzle (place  ND[mm] ) Bottom sampler (set)  2020 1 1 1(1) 1  80 1 3000 ~ 5000 1 1 1(1) 1  100 1 10000 1 2 1(2) 1  100 1 20200 ~ 30000 1 2 2(2) 2  100 1  50000 1 3 2(2) 2  100 1 Notes:  It is remended to provide cleaning hole for crude oil tank. 8  It is remended to provide blowdown holes for light oil tanks. The fixed roof tank shall be provided with vent tube (or breather valve), oil dip hole, loophole, manhole, blowdown hole (or cleaning hole), drain nozzle and bottom sampler. The principle for arrangement and numbers of the parts shall ply with the following provisions: 1. Vent tube or breather valve a.
